Frequently Asked Questions about the 11101 ZIP Code

How much are Studio apartments in 11101?

There are currently 1,242 Studio Apartments in 11101 with rent ranges from $1,400 to $4,650 with an average price of $3,504.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om 11101 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in 11101 ranges from $1,280 to $10,596 with an average monthly rent of $4,618.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in 11101 c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in 11101 range from $1,500 to $22,290.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$6,361.

How expensive are 11101 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 190 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in 11101 on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,700 to $32,760 - averaging $9,212 for the location.
